Harry F. Cann

...retired from Raytheon and Harcan Ind.; 87

TEWKSBURY - Harry F. Cann, 87, a former buyer for Raytheon, and owner of HarcanIndustries, died Sunday afternoon, April 7, at his Tewksbury home following a brief illness. Hewas the husband of Elsie W. (Williams) Cann, with whom he had celebrated a 63rd weddinganniversary this past September 17th.

He was born in Ingonish, Cape Breton, Nova Scotia, April 4, 1915, a son of the late Daniel andReta (Coleman) Cann. He lived in Cape Breton until moving to Watertown, Mass. in his 10thyear. He graduated from Watertown High School, and later attended Bentley School ofAccounting and Business. He raised his family in Billerica, and moved to Tewksbury 39 yearsago.

He retired from Raytheon’s Purchasing Department at the former South Lowell Plant in 1972. He continued his career as founder and owner of Harcan Industries, machinists and manufacturerof small parts.

He was a member of St. Anne’s Episcopal Church in North Billerica.

He enjoyed golf, bowling, was an avid HO model train enthusiast, and CB’er using the handle“Herring choker.” During his Raytheon years, he also belonged to the Raytheon ManagementClub.

Besides his wife, he is survived by a daughter Janice MacLeod and her husband EugeneGeaumont of No. Waterboro, Maine, three sons, Richard and his wife Joanne (Smith) Cann ofPort Orange, Fla., Allen Cann and Carole Colantoni of Haverhill, and Barry Cann of Wilmington,14 grandchildren, and 31 great grandchildren.

He was predeceased by a sister Grace Cann, a brother, William Cann, and a grandson, KennethCann who died in 1986.

His Funeral Service was held Tuesday, April 9, in St. Anne’s Episcopal Church, No. Billerica. Interment was in Fox Hill Cemetery, Billerica.
